    Microneedling, also known as collagen induction therapy, is a popular skin rejuvenation treatment that involves using tiny needles to create micro-injuries in the skin. These micro-injuries stimulate the body's natural healing process, promoting collagen and elastin production, which can improve skin texture, reduce the appearance of scars, and minimize fine lines and wrinkles.

    In Quebec City, the frequency of microneedling sessions can vary depending on individual skin goals, skin type, and the specific concerns being addressed. Generally, it is recommended to start with a series of treatments spaced 4 to 6 weeks apart. This interval allows the skin to heal and for the full benefits of each session to be realized.

    For those looking to address mild to moderate skin concerns, such as fine lines, mild acne scars, or uneven skin tone, a series of 3 to 4 treatments may be sufficient. However, for more significant concerns like deep acne scars or advanced signs of aging, additional sessions may be necessary, potentially up to 6 treatments.

    After completing an initial series of treatments, many individuals choose to maintain their results with occasional maintenance sessions, typically scheduled every 3 to 6 months. This helps to sustain the improvements and keep the skin looking its best.

    Understanding the Frequency of Microneedling Treatments in Quebec City

    As a medical professional specializing in aesthetic treatments, I often receive inquiries about the optimal frequency for microneedling sessions. Microneedling, a procedure that involves the use of fine needles to create micro-injuries in the skin, stimulates collagen production and promotes skin rejuvenation. In Quebec City, the frequency of these treatments can vary based on individual skin conditions, treatment goals, and the specific protocol followed by your practitioner.

    Initial Treatment Plan

    For most patients, a series of treatments spaced four to six weeks apart is recommended initially. This interval allows the skin to heal and for the full benefits of collagen stimulation to be realized. During this period, you may notice improvements in skin texture, reduction in fine lines, and a more even skin tone.

    Maintenance Treatments

    Once the initial series of treatments is complete, maintenance sessions can be scheduled less frequently, typically every three to six months. These maintenance treatments help to sustain the improvements achieved and can be adjusted based on your skin's response and your aesthetic goals.

    Factors Influencing Frequency

    Several factors can influence the frequency of your microneedling sessions:

    1. Skin Type and Condition: Individuals with more resilient skin may require fewer treatments, while those with sensitive or acne-prone skin might need a more cautious approach.
    2. Treatment Goals: If your goal is to address specific concerns like acne scars or deep wrinkles, you may need a more intensive treatment plan initially.
    3. Practitioner's Recommendations: Always follow the advice of your dermatologist or aesthetician, as they can tailor the treatment frequency to your unique needs.

    Post-Treatment Care

    Proper post-treatment care is crucial to maximize the benefits of microneedling. This includes avoiding sun exposure, using gentle skincare products, and following any specific instructions provided by your practitioner.
